Love/Juice (2000)
Love/Juice is a 2000 Japanese-language drama movie directed by Kaze Shindo, with a running time of 1h 18m. It stars Mika Okuno, Chika Fujimura and Hidetoshi Nishijima.
Twenty-something lesbian Chinatsu shares a one-bedroom apartment with heterosexual Kyoko. Although Chinatsu and Kyoko have a passing attraction, Kyoko is mostly interested in men, especially one who tends the fish in a pet store, who despite her efforts, doesn't seem to be interested in her.
